The Sandman Chapter 6 "The Sound of Her Wings" Details Episode Directed by Mairzee Almas Teleplay for this episode written by Lauren Bello Staff Writers Catherine Smyth-McMullen and Vanessa Benton After recovering his helm, pouch of sand and ruby, Morpheus feels aimless and unmotivated like there is something missing from his duties. But his big sister, Death, comes to meet him and asks her brother to accompany her as she escorts the deceased to the afterlife.She explains that there was a time in her history that she too felt that she was just going through the motions as the inevitable end for everyone. As she goes about her work she shows Morpheus the possibility of finding purpose and fulfilment in his duties as ruler of the Dreaming, as she has since realised that she is the last connection that all beings have before they leave the world. All they crave is a friendly smile and a kind ear.Morpheus is reminded of a bet he once made with his sister after overhearing a young man called Hob Gadling declare that he will never die as he believes that life only ends when you give up. In the White Horse Tavern in the year 1389 Death agrees to spare Gadling and grant him his wish for as long as he wants with the agreement that he will meet dream at the same spot every 100 years and tell him of his experiences.Each time they meet, Hob Gadling describes his life and maintains that no matter the turns his life takes, he still does not wish for death. Through the wonderful or awful centuries or whether his mysterious meetings with Dream are being investigated by Johanna Constantine, Hob reiterates that his life is his life and he never wants it to end.In 1889 their conversation leads to Hob hypothesizing that Morpheus continues to meet with him because he is lonely and needs a friend, which greatly offends Morpheus. As the next century passes, Morpheus fails to show for their next meeting due to his capture by Burgess. When their age-old drinking hole is sold, Hob chooses a new tavern a block away, hoping that Morpheus will choose to find him.In the present, with his Sister's words of encouragement in his ears and craving connection again Morpheus seeks out Hob Gadling who joyfully greets his Endless drinking companion as the two friends catch up on missed time. The Sandman Chapter 5 "24/7" Details Episode Directed by Jamie Childs Teleplay for this episode written by Ameni Rozsa Staff Writers Catherine Smyth-McMullen and Vanessa Benton With Dream's ruby in hand and Morpheus caught off guard and unconscious, John Dee stops off at a diner to watch the people around him, encountering the polite employees and hungry patrons. But all is not what it seems, as John settles into his booth and his hot black coffee, he uses the ruby to remove any lies from the group and put his theory about truth and lies to a terrifying test. John Dee begins with server Bette and removes her kind demeanor towards her customers, he then turns his attention and that of the Ruby towards power couple, husband and wife Garry and Kate, to just be honest with each other as they squabble over spinach salad and double decker burgers. As Bette's love interest, Marsh, is also exposed to the scrutiny of John's Ruby as he forces a matter-of-fact confession that the only reason he comes to her home is not to be with her but to be with her 21 year old son Bernard. As John turns his vision of absolute truth on to Judy who has recently broken up with her girlfriend, and on Mark, a hopeful employee of Vanguard Pharmaceuticals, the unconnected group spirals out of control with one another. Judy kisses Bette as Kate gets down with hopefully employee Mark and her husband Garry hooks up with Marsh. As John Dee takes pride in the honesty he has brought to the diner, he has also brought about jealousy and anger overtakes these innocent people when Mark accidentally murders Garry, driving them to murder each other or take their own lives. The Lord of Dreams arrives too late but tries to explain to John that what he thinks are lies are another form of dreams and hopes. But John refuses to listen to him and Morpheus transports him to his Realm to retrieve the Ruby, but where John has other plans as he uses the ruby's power to defeat Morpheus. Crushing the ruby in his hand, John exults in his victory, before Morpheus reveals himself and tells him that by destroying the ruby, its power was released and reforged back into its true master, Morpheus. Taking pity on John, Morpheus returns him to the institution, seemingly in a state of long-term sleep. With the wider world also recovering from John's intervention, Morpheus's sibling Desire plots against him. On OCD’s 7th day of 31 days of horror, Tess is joined by Mhari Goldstein from Comics, Culture, Cosplay podcast to talk Neil Gaiman’s 1989 “The Sandman!”New York Times bestselling author Neil Gaiman's transcendent series Sandman is often hailed as the definitive Vertigo title and one of the finest achievements in graphic storytelling. Gaiman created an unforgettable tale of the forces that exist beyond life and death by weaving ancient mythology, folklore and fairy tales with his own distinct narrative vision. In Preludes & Nocturnes, an occultist attempting to capture Death to bargain for eternal life traps her younger brother Dream instead. After his seventy-year imprisonment and eventual escape, Dream, also known as Morpheus, goes on a quest for his lost objects of power. On his arduous journey Morpheus encounters Lucifer, John Constantine, and an all-powerful madman. Elseworlds: At the end of night one of the crossover, we found out that Dr. John Deegan was given the book by the Monitor and was in Gotham City. After detouring though Star City, Ollie-Flash, Barry-Arrow and Supergirl head over to Gotham. They run into some muggers and are taken into custody by the GCPD. They are sprung and taken to Wayne Tower. There they are greeted by Kate Kane. She has taken over the tower and offers to let them use it. They learn from her that Deegan is over Arkham and head over there for answers. Cisco, Kaitlin, and Diggle show up filling them in on the appearance of Earth 90's Flash and the message. Kara & Kaitlin distract the staff. Barry & Oliver confront Deegan, who frees the inmates and escapes. In a battle with an inmate Scarecrow's fear toxin is spilt and Arrow & Flash battle each other thinking they are battling Merlin & Thawne. Batwoman comes to save the day. In Arkham we had shout outs to Mister Freeze, Scarecrow, Penguin, Poison Ivy, Clayface, Riddler, Psycho-Pirate and the Luke Fox a.k.a. Batwing. Elseworlds - Batwoman Saves The Day: Elseworlds saw the formal introduction of Batwoman and the city of Gotham into the CW Flarrowverse. It seems that Bruce/Batman left Gotham 3 years ago and it fell to pieces. Wayne Enterprises fell and so did the city. They seem to be canonizing that this is the Nolan Batman's Gotham. But Bruce's cousin Kate Kane is on the job as Batwoman. It seems even she doesn't know where Batman went. But she is there to protect her city. All the drama that our heroes are bringing is making things worse. She just wants them out of the city. However she and Supergirl are World's Finest in her eyes. They both know each other's secret identities. Our heroes may have left Gotham, but we have not seen the last of Batwoman.
